PERMSKI

Volume 14 · 59 words · 1797 Edition

or PERMIA, a town of the Russian empire, and capital of a province of the same name, seated on the river Kama between the Dwina and the Obi; E. Long. 55. 50. N. Lat. 70. 26. The province is bounded on the north by the Samoiedes, on the west by Zirania and Ulatka, and on the east by Siberia.
